The American Idol Season 9 Top 8 guys took the stage last night for a spot in the final 12.
Michael Lynche (A.K.A. “Big Mike”) turned in one of the greatest Idol performances of all time with his rendition of Maxwell‘s version of Kate Bush‘s “This Woman’s Work”.
It was easily the best performance of the evening. Ellen DeGeneres said that Big Mike is the one to beat. Kara DioGuardi was in tears (in tears, people!) and could hardly speak because it was so good. Simon Cowell said they needed a performance like that after a fairly boring show.
I would have to agree. Up until that point it had mainly been a bunch of average-looking guys singing average-sounding songs and they all had been playing the guitar. YAWN!
This performance lit up the stage, though.
